Ability to drive projects forward under tight deadlines.\n \n Analytical & Systematic: High attention to detail; able to synthesize complex technical requirements into actionable manufacturing and assembly instructions.\n \n Leadership: Ability to lead technical discussions, influence factory output, and resolve conflicts in a fast-paced delivery environment.\n ## Description As a Lead Engineer for Power Quality Products, you will be the technical lead responsible for the successful execution of projects from order intake through to final delivery. You will own the technical integrity of the solution, ensuring that what was promised to the customer is delivered on time, within budget, and to the highest quality standards. You will act as the key interface between customers, internal project management, factories, and external vendors, managing technical dimensioning, component procurement, and final documentation.\n, Post-Order Execution: Take ownership of the project engineering phase immediately upon order intake. Ensure all technical requirements are fulfilled according to the contract and project schedule.\n \n Technical Dimensioning: Perform detailed system engineering, including sizing and dimensioning of Reactive Power Compensation (RPC) equipment to ensure compliance with customer technical specifications and grid code requirements.\n \n Vendor & Factory Liaison: Serve as the technical primary point of contact for factories and third-party vendors. Manage equipment specifications, monitor production progress, and ensure quality control during manufacturing.\n \n Project Management Support: Collaborate closely with Project Managers to maintain project timelines. Provide technical status updates, identify potential bottlenecks, and proactively resolve engineering-related issues.\n \n Customer Interface: Act as the technical face of the project for the customer. Lead technical meetings, manage design approvals, and ensure customer satisfaction regarding the delivered hardware and documentation.\n \n Documentation & Quality: Oversee the creation of all required project documentation, including electrical schematics, assembly manuals, and test reports. Ensure all deliverables meet internal quality and safety standards.\n \n Problem Solving: Provide expert-level technical troubleshooting should challenges arise during manufacturing, testing, or final project handover.\n \n ## Related Videos - [Model Based Systems Engineering in an Agile Product Development Process](https://www.wearedevelopers.com/videos/68-model-based-systems-engineering-in-an-agile-product-development-process) - [Valven Atlas: Engineering Intelligence That Delivers](https://www.wearedevelopers.com/videos/1660-valven-atlas-engineering-intelligence-that-delivers) - [Are Classical Automation Frameworks Dead?
